You are on page 1of 2

%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%

%
Mtodo de Gauss-Jordan
%
%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
% Jlio Csar Magalhaes de Freitas
0609535-6 %
% Luana Mara Lacerda
100950024 %
% Viviane Manuela Vale
112200084 %
%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%
clc
clear all
close all
load matriz_100.txt
load matriz_200.txt
load matriz_300.txt
a1=matriz_100;
f=input('Entre com o nmero de linhas da matriz 100: ');
c=input('Entre com o nmero de colunas da matriz 100: ');
tic
for k=1:c-1
a1(k,:)=a1(k,:)/a1(k,k);
for j=k+1:f
a1(j,:)=a1(j,:)-a1(k,:)*a1(j,k);
j=j+1;
end
k=k+1;
end
for k=f:-1:2
for j=k-1:-1:1
a1(j,:)=a1(j,:)-a1(k,:)*a1(j,k);
j=j-1;
end
k=k-1;
end
d=a1;
Resultado_matriz_100=a1(:,c)
toc
disp('-----------------------------------------------------------------------------------------------------------------------')
disp('')
a2=matriz_200;
f=input('Entre com o nmero de linhas da matriz 200: ');
c=input('Entre com o nmero de colunas da matriz 200: ');
tic
for k=1:c-1
a2(k,:)=a2(k,:)/a2(k,k);
for j=k+1:f
a2(j,:)=a2(j,:)-a2(k,:)*a2(j,k);
j=j+1;
end
k=k+1;

end
for k=f:-1:2
for j=k-1:-1:1
a2(j,:)=a2(j,:)-a2(k,:)*a2(j,k);
j=j-1;
end
k=k-1;
end
d=a2;
Resultado_matriz_200=a2(:,c)
toc
disp('----------------------------------------------------------------------------------------------------------------------')
disp('')
a3=matriz_300;
f=input('Entre com o nmero de linhas da matriz 300: ');
c=input('Entre com o nmero de colunas da matriz 300: ');
tic
for k=1:c-1
a3(k,:)=a3(k,:)/a3(k,k);
for j=k+1:f
a3(j,:)=a3(j,:)-a3(k,:)*a3(j,k);
j=j+1;
end
k=k+1;
end
for k=f:-1:2
for j=k-1:-1:1
a3(j,:)=a3(j,:)-a3(k,:)*a3(j,k);
j=j-1;
end
k=k-1;
end
d=a3;
Resultado_matriz_300=a3(:,c)
toc